Hello all, I'm trying to find information on buying an Early Bird Season Lift Pass for Hakuba Goryu/Hakuba 47. I know you can buy one for a discounted price of 48,000 Yen before 31st October and i have had a look on both their websites but i'm having difficulty finding out if i can buy one from the UK. Does anyone know if you can do it ? Has anyone bought a season pass from abroad ? Any information will be greatly appreciated. Cheers wallas
